Toyota RAV4 Key Fob Battery: Replacement Guide for 2019 Models

Replacing the key fob battery for your 2019 Toyota RAV4 is a straightforward task that can save you time and money. This guide will provide you with all the necessary information to successfully change the battery in your key fob.
Key Fob Battery Specifications
The 2019 Toyota RAV4 key fob uses a CR2032 lithium battery. This type of battery is widely available and known for its reliability and longevity.
Steps to Replace the Key Fob Battery
1. Gather Your Tools: You will need a new CR2032 battery and a small flathead screwdriver or the mechanical key from the fob.
2. Remove the Mechanical Key: Locate the release tab on your key fob and press it to pull out the mechanical key.
3. Open the Key Fob: Insert the mechanical key into the notch where it was housed, and gently twist it to pry open the two halves of the fob.
4. Remove the Old Battery: Once opened, locate the battery. Use your flathead screwdriver to carefully lift out the old battery from its compartment.
5. Insert the New Battery: Place the new CR2032 battery into the compartment, ensuring that the positive side (+) is facing up.
6. Reassemble the Key Fob: Snap the two halves of the fob back together until you hear a click, indicating it is securely closed.
7. Test Your Key Fob: Press any button on your key fob to ensure it is functioning properly.
Important Tips
- Always dispose of old batteries properly, following local regulations.
- If your key fob does not work after replacing the battery, double-check that it is installed correctly and that no debris is interfering with the contacts.
- Regularly check your key fob battery every couple of years to avoid unexpected failures.
FAQs About Toyota RAV4 Key Fob Battery
- How often should I replace my key fob battery?
It is recommended to replace your key fob battery every 2-3 years or when you notice decreased performance. - Can I use any CR2032 battery?
Yes, as long as it is a standard CR2032 lithium battery, it should work correctly. - Do I need to reprogram my key fob after changing the battery?
No, typically you do not need to reprogram your key fob after replacing the battery.
